Book Description

March 29, 2003 0750674555 978-0750674553 2
High-Rise Security and Fire Life Safety servers as an essential took for building architects, building owners and property managers, security and fire safety directors, security consultants, and contract security firms.

* Provides the reader with complete coverage of high-rise security and safety issues
* Includes comprehensive sample documentation, diagrams, photographs to aid in developing security and fire life safety programs
* Serves as an essential tool for building owners and managers, security and fire safety directors, security consultants and contract security firms

for investors, managers, and inspectors of tall buildings, this is an exceptionally useful book. Mr. Graighead combines his Australian roots and his California experience in a clear guide to fire safety and security management of these "vertical villages." I have quoted from this work in forums around the world, and have made this book a special present for colleagues in the fire service and architecture and "authorities having jurisdiction." It is a how- to and why guide to active systems. I recommend it highly. And, given that so many skyscrapers are now being built in Asia and in Latin America, I hope this is translated into Chinese, Korean, Spanish and Portuguese. - Richard A. "Nick" Candee, Executive Director, Global Operations, NFPA International
